Output 835963132240a561489992a901a88cddc934acb870347c598a47db9cb06bae33:2

value
25235000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a4588dae825c2872e6a8f0d971f5b347d3d67b1 OP_EQUAL
address
MHb5A7TqWtNYrWhDq32AX9H6mSAN17XrYX
transaction
835963132240a561489992a901a88cddc934acb870347c598a47db9cb06bae33
spent
true